免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

苹果ios企业签名怎么在线做呢

苹果iOS企业签名是指通过企业证书进行签名,以使应用程序可以在非官方渠道(如企业内部分发)上安装和运行。相较于在App Store上发布应用,企业签名允许开发者直接将应用程序分发给企业员工或特定用户,无需经过苹果的审核流程。

下面是一份详细介绍和原理解释,可供参考:

一、原理介绍:

苹果为了保证应用在iOS设备上的安全性和稳定性,规定了只有通过App Store下载的应用才能在设备上安装和运行。然而,为了方便企业员工或特定用户快速获取应用,苹果提供了企业签名的机制。通过企业签名,企业开发者可以使用企业证书来对应用进行签名,从而允许企业内部或特定用户通过接收应用的IPA(iOS App文件)进行安装和使用。

二、步骤详解:

1. 获取企业开发者账号:要进行企业签名,首先需要获得苹果的企业开发者账号。这个账号和普通的开发者账号不同,需要满足一定的条件才能申请到。

2. 创建App ID:在企业开发者账号下,创建一个新的App ID。App ID是用来唯一标识一个应用程序的字符串,包括一个Team ID和一个Bundle ID(应用程序的包名)。

3. 创建证书:为了进行签名,需要创建一个用于签名的证书。在iOS开发者网站上,可以通过证书向导创建一个申请证书的CSR文件,并提交给苹果的开发者中心。苹果会审核并签发证书,然后将证书下载到本地机器上。

4. 创建描述文件:描述文件将企业开发者账号、App ID和证书进行绑定。描述文件包含了设备列表、App ID、证书等相关信息。在创建描述文件时,需要选择特定的证书以及将要分发应用程序的设备列表。

5. 打包应用程序:在Xcode中,选择对应的项目,设置好企业开发者账号,并选择创建好的证书和描述文件。然后,使用"Archive"功能将项目打包成IPA文件。

6. 分发应用程序:将IPA文件上传到企业内部的分发渠道,比如企业内部的网站或应用分发平台。用户可以通过点击下载链接来安装应用程序。

7. 安装应用程序:用户需要在设备上安装苹果的企业证书才能正常安装企业签名的应用程序。用户从分发渠道下载IPA后,点击安装,然后在“设置”>“通用”>“描述文件与设备管理”中信任企业证书。

8. 更新应用程序:当应用程序有更新时,开发者可以重新打包并替换原有的IPA文件,然后将新的IPA文件上传到分发渠道。用户会收到应用更新的通知,可以通过下载链接下载并安装新的应用程序。

三、注意事项:

1. 企业签名只适用于企业内部或特定用户分发,严禁将签名后的应用程序发布到App Store上。

2. 不能将企业签名的应用程序分发给未经授权的用户。

3. 若企业账号或证书到期,需及时更新和续费,否则签名的应用程序将无法正常使用。

总结:

通过企业签名,开发者可以将应用程序快速分发给企业员工或特定用户,无需经过App Store审核。企业签名的原理是使用企业证书对应用程序进行签名,以实现在企业内部和特定用户的设备上安装和使用。需要注意的是,企业签名仅适用于非公开的分发,且要遵守相关规定和注意事项。希望本文对你理解和掌握苹果iOS企业签名有所帮助。


相关知识:
ios越狱签名码
iOS越狱签名码是一种用于安装和运行未经过苹果官方审查的应用程序的技术。通过越狱签名码,用户可以越过iOS系统的限制,自由地安装第三方应用程序和修改系统设置。本文将对iOS越狱签名码的原理和详细介绍进行阐述。1. iOS越狱的原理iOS系统被苹果严格控制,
2023-07-18
p12证书私钥是怎么写入的
P12证书是一种常见的数字证书文件格式,它通常用于客户端认证和安全通信。P12证书文件中包含了一对公钥和私钥,私钥是用于对数据进行加密和签名的关键。P12证书私钥的写入过程可以简要分为以下几个步骤:1. 生成密钥对:首先,需要生成一对公钥和私钥。这可以通过
2023-07-18
安卓手机安装app取消验证签名
在安卓手机上安装应用程序(App)时,通常会校验应用程序的数字签名以确保其完整性和安全性。这样可以防止恶意软件和未经授权的应用程序进入设备。然而,有时我们可能需要绕过这个验证过程来安装不经过正式渠道发行的应用程序,这可能是因为我们想自行开发应用程序或安装来
2023-07-17
修改安卓安装包签名
安卓应用程序包(APK)签名是一种安全机制,目的是验证应用程序的完整性和真实性,并防止恶意篡改。在Android开发中,每个APK都必须经过签名才能被安装和运行。APK签名的原理是通过使用数字证书来对应用程序进行加密。数字证书由密钥对组成,即公钥和私钥。开
2023-07-17
怎么获取apk的签名文件
APK的签名文件是用于验证应用程序的身份和完整性的重要文件。它由开发者使用私钥对APK进行数字签名生成,然后将公钥嵌入到APK中。当用户下载应用并安装时,系统会验证APK的签名来确保应用来自于可信的来源且未被篡改。下面是获取APK签名文件的方法:1. 使用
2023-07-17
apk签名保存在哪个文件夹
APK签名是确保应用的完整性和安全性的重要步骤。在Android应用程序中,APK签名以数字证书的形式存在,并保存在APK包文件的META-INF目录下。实际上,APK签名包含两个文件:一个是具有.jks或.keystore扩展名的密钥库文件,另一个是具有
2023-07-17
©2015-2021 成都七扇门科技有限公司 y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-4